Tortoise on the tracks brings rush hour to a standstill

Must read

We’ve all heard of leaves on the line causing railway delays but on Friday evening it was a tortoise on the tracks that was to blame.

A train had to stop and pick up an escaped tortoise called Solomon who had been spotted moving “at pace” along the tracks outside Ascot, Berkshire, at around 6pm. There were delays to services between Ascot in Berkshire and Bagshot in Surrey as he was brought on to the train.

Pictures showed Solomon withdrawn into his shell on the floor of the train and later being carried by two railway staff.
